Former Taoyuan Mayor and Chairman of the Taiwan Strait Exchange Foundation Zheng Wen-Can was reportedly arrested in connection with corruption charges. The Taoyuan District Prosecutors' Office confirmed the arrest and stated that if convicted, he could face a minimum of 7 years in prison under the Anti-Corruption Act. The alleged case involves Zheng assisting in a land development project in exchange for a payment, which was later returned after the project did not proceed as planned.
